OSH ACT of 1970 Section (5)(a)(1): The employer did not furnish employment and a place of employment which were free from recognized hazards that were causing or likely to cause death or serious physical harm to employees. a.) On or about 6/18/2020 in the boat's storage yard, the employer failed to obligate employees who operate the company's forklift to use a seat belt, exposing them to crush-by and struck-by hazards.

29 CFR 1910.178(l)(4)(iii): An evaluation of each powered industrial truck operator's performance shall be conducted at least once every three years. a.) On or about 06/18/2020, the employer at the boat repair shop, failed to conduct an evaluation of each powered industrial truck operator's performance, exposing employees to possible injuries related to the unsafe operation of powered industrial trucks.

29 CFR 1910.178(m)(5)(iii): When the operator of an industrial truck is dismounted and within 25 ft. of the truck still in his view, the load engaging means shall be fully lowered, controls neutralized, and the brakes set to prevent movement. a.) On or about 06/18/2020, at the boat repair shop's yard, the forklift operator who was within 25 ft of the truck, did not ensure that the load was lowered, the powered industrial truck's controls were neutralized and the brakes set to prevent movement, exposing employees to struck-by and fall hazards.

29 CFR 1904.39(a)(2): Basic Requirement. Within twenty-four (24) hours after the in-patient hospitalization of one or more employees or an employee's amputation or an employee's loss of an eye, as a result of a work-related incident, you must report the in-patient hospitalization, amputation, or loss of an eye to OSHA. a.) At the job site, on 6/11/2020 the employer called OSHA to report an in-patient hospitalization which occurred on 6/09/2020.
